(310) 234-8600 Los Angeles, CA

Contact Us

We would be delighted to answer any questions you may have.

If you provide us with a cell phone number to text us, you are agreeing to an SMS communication with our company.

  • Phone Number:
  • Fax:
    (424) 248-1291
  • Physical / Mailing Address
    10801 National Blvd, Suite 515
    Los Angeles, CA 90064